Rapid Influenza Diagnostics Market - Growth Drivers and Challenges

Growth Drivers

  • Ongoing research and development funding by public health agencies: The government research organizations continue to invest in the development of new generations of rapid influenza diagnostics focused on sensitivity and quicker results. The focus is to achieve better accuracy in the diagnosis of diseases and to take into consideration a large number of strains of influenza. Funding supports the development of molecular assays and new technologies that meet regulatory standards, helping their quick use in clinical settings. The R&D initiatives support the innovation pipelines and further sustain the growth of the market.
  • Increased demand for rapid and accurate influenza detection: The need for rapid influenza diagnostic tests in healthcare facilities is increasing to detect influenza infections quickly and to distinguish them from other respiratory conditions. According to a CDC September 2024 report, a rapid influenza diagnostic test can provide results in less than 15 minutes. This timely detection helps manage patients efficiently and prevents the spread of infection in hospitals, clinics, and long-term care facilities. Preparedness and early intervention have become a priority, especially during flu seasons and other respiratory outbreaks, driving demand for fast and reliable diagnostic tools at the point of care, thus creating a positive impact in the market.
  • Government initiatives enhancing testing capacity and outbreak management: The expansion of diagnostic testing capabilities by federal health agencies to strengthen the public health response is another growth driver for the market. Programs to improve rapid influenza diagnostic tests and molecular assays in urban and rural areas are prioritized for timely outbreak detection and management. Government investments help ensure that laboratories and healthcare providers use these diagnostics in daily treatment for better disease surveillance and control. Institutional support is an important factor in market growth and innovation.

Influenza Diagnostic Tests (2022)

Method

Accuracy

Comments

Rapid antigen test

Sensitivity: 40% to 80%, Specificity: High

Detects influenza A/B antigens via lateral flow or immunofluorescent assay; results in 10 to 15 minutes; point-of-care use; multiplex tests detect SARS-CoV-2 too; analyser devices improve sensitivity.

Rapid molecular assay

Sensitivity: >95%, Specificity: >99%

Detects viral RNA via nucleic acid amplification; results in 15 to 40 minutes; requires a small analyzer; some point-of-care multiplex tests detect SARS-CoV-2, influenza A/B, and RSV.

Molecular assay (lab-based)

Sensitivity: >95%, Specificity: >99%

Detects viral RNA; 45 to 80 minutes (up to 4 to 6 hours); requires complex machinery, certified labs, and qualified staff; multiplex detects SARS-CoV-2, influenza A/B, subtypes, and other pathogens.

Immunofluorescence assay

Sensitivity: Moderate, Specificity: High

Detects antigens via fluorescent staining; 1 to 4 hours; requires fluorescent microscope, certified labs, skilled personnel; sensitivity depends on sample prep; less commonly used.

Virus culture

Sensitivity: High, Specificity: High

Isolation of viable virus in tissue culture; 1 to 10 days; requires qualified personnel and complex lab setup; shell-vial culture yields results in 1 to 3 days; standard culture takes 3 to 10 days.

Source: NLM August 2022

Challenges

  • Regulatory compliance and quality assurance: Rapid flu test suppliers face extremely demanding criteria concerning test accuracy, sensitivity, and specificity. Therefore, the manufacturers need to carry out rigorous testing and continued quality control, which slows down the pace of product development and thereby affects cost potential, thereby negatively impacting the market. Meeting the ever-changing FDA and CDC regulations is an expensive proposition, and maintaining consistency while limiting market entry and mass manufacture. Regulatory burden affects incumbents and entrants alike.
  • Supply chain disruptions and material sourcing: Manufacturing of quick flu tests relies on a sophisticated global supply chain of raw materials, reagents, and specialized parts. Any disruption in the international supply chain, such as a delay in import-export logistics or a lack of some very important raw materials, can disrupt the continuity of production. Such problems act against the availability and timely delivery during the peak of flu season or in moments of an outbreak associations and so undermine the responsiveness of healthcare providers. Therefore, with such disruptions, the market is facing hindrances in its growth internationally.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

In the year 2025, the industry size of the rapid influenza diagnostics market was valued at USD 1.5 billion.

The market size for the rapid influenza diagnostics market is projected to reach USD 2.9 billion by the end of 2035, expanding at a CAGR of approximately 8.7% during the forecast period, i.e., between 2026–2035.

The major players in the market are Abbott Laboratories, F. Hoffmann-La Roche Ltd, Quidel Corporation,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c., and others.

In terms of technology, the lateral flow immunoassays subsegment is anticipated to garner the largest market share of 43% by 2035 and exhibit substantial growth opportunities during 2026–2035.

The market in North America is projected to hold the largest market share of 37% by the end of 2035 and offer substantial business opportunities in the coming years.
